Skip to Content
เมนู
คุณต้องลงทะเบียนเพื่อโต้ตอบกับคอมมูนิตี้
คำถามนี้ถูกตั้งค่าสถานะ
2 ตอบกลับ
12725 มุมมอง

how to browse all user record , if i browse record only i can get who entered

อวตาร
ละทิ้ง
คำตอบที่ดีที่สุด

Hi,

You need to browse using uid=1 i.e as a ADMIN USER. Other wise record rules will restrict them.

Thanks,

อวตาร
ละทิ้ง
ผู้เขียน

lines = crm_obj.search(self.cr, self.uid, [('date_open','>=',d1), ('date_open','<=',d2)])
if lines: date_br = crm_obj.browse(self.cr,self.uid,lines)---->here i can get only admin record(i need to get all user record how to get it) print date_br.name,"6666666666666666"

try this crm_obj.browse(self.cr,1,lines) but this is not good practice as it breaks security

ผู้เขียน

yes thanks

คำตอบที่ดีที่สุด

To get all IDs of users, you need to search for users with blank list which will return list of IDs of all users. Then you can browse them all.

Try this:

user_ids = self.search(cr, uid, [], context=context)
for user in self.browse(cr, uid, user_ids, context=context):
    #Your code goes here
อวตาร
ละทิ้ง